Thought for the day, Sunday 18th July
“There is only one breath. All are made of the same clay. Light within all is the same.”Guru Gobind Singh, tenth Guru of Sikhism, quoted in Fragments of Holiness for Daily Reflection

Thought for the day, Friday 16th July
“Three things cannot be retrieved:The arrow once sped from the bowThe word spoken in hasteThe missed opportunity.”Ali the Lion, Caliph of Islam, son-in-law of Muhammad the Prophet (peace be upon him), quoted in Caravan of Dreams by Idries Shah
Thought for the day, Thursday 15th July
“The reality of Divinity is like an endless ocean. Revelation may be likened to the rain. Can you imagine the cessation of rain? Ever on the face of the earth somewhere rain is pouring down.”Abdu’l Baha (1844 – 1921), head of the Baha’i faith from 1892 to 1921
